Healthcare Regulations and Their Impact
Navigating healthcare regulations is crucial for the sustainability and profitability of rehab centers. Compliance with these regulations ensures centers avoid legal pitfalls and penalties that could erode profits. Regulations often dictate operational standards and insurance practices, which can affect how centers manage their resources and deliver care. These standards are not just bureaucratic hurdles; they are essential for ensuring the safety, quality, and effectiveness of healthcare services provided to patients.
Healthcare regulations encompass a wide range of areas, including patient privacy laws like HIPAA, accreditation requirements from bodies such as The Joint Commission, and state-specific mandates that can vary significantly. Each of these regulations requires regular audits and updates to ensure compliance. Failure to adhere to these regulations can result in fines, loss of accreditation, and damage to the center’s reputation, all of which can have long-term financial implications.
Understanding and adapting to changes in healthcare regulations is essential for maintaining profitability. Staying informed about policy changes and investing in compliance measures can help rehab centers mitigate risks associated with regulatory breaches. This involves continuous education and training for staff, investing in compliance software, and engaging in regular audits to identify and address potential non-compliance issues before they escalate. Building a robust compliance framework not only protects the center from legal issues but also enhances operational efficiency by standardizing processes and ensuring consistent delivery of care.
Patient Outcomes and Profitability
Improving patient outcomes is not only a moral obligation but also a strategic advantage for rehab centers. Higher patient satisfaction and success rates in recovery programs can enhance the center’s reputation, leading to increased referrals and patient retention. Behavioral therapy and comprehensive treatment plans are key components in achieving superior patient outcomes. By employing a patient-centered approach, rehab centers can address the unique needs of each individual, leading to more effective and sustainable recovery paths.
Centers that invest in quality care and innovative treatment approaches are more likely to see positive patient outcomes, which in turn improve their financial performance. This creates a cycle where better outcomes lead to higher demand and profitability. Innovative treatments may include the integration of technology in therapy, such as virtual reality for exposure therapy or mobile apps for ongoing patient engagement and support. Furthermore, leveraging data analytics to track patient progress and outcomes can provide valuable insights into the effectiveness of treatments, allowing for continuous improvement and personalization of care plans.
